Output f3298917d08d8c76fc0effb8e582a559c29acca8e9448551f911f3ba579b5a8f:0

value
21523646
script pubkey
OP_0 OP_PUSHBYTES_20 d273c823754a1b690179ca5533662f7eb043f8bb
address
bc1q6feusgm4fgdkjqteef2nxe3006cy879m7was8j
transaction
f3298917d08d8c76fc0effb8e582a559c29acca8e9448551f911f3ba579b5a8f
spent
true